About University of Puerto Rico-Arecibo

University of Puerto Rico-Arecibo is a mid-sized institution located in Arecibo, Puerto Rico, primarily awarding the bachelor's degree. It enrolls roughly 2,669 undergraduate students in a city setting. The most popular fields of study include Health professions, Business, Biological sciences.

Cost & tuition

The average net price at University of Puerto Rico-Arecibo — what a typical student actually pays after grants and scholarships — is $10,680 per year, which is moderately priced compared to other U.S. institutions. Published tuition is $5,354 per year before aid. Total cost of attendance, including housing, books, and living expenses, comes to about $17,710 annually.

Graduation & earnings outcomes

The 6-year graduation rate is 52.0%, a above-average completion outcome. 76.1% of first-time students return for a second year, a useful proxy for student satisfaction and academic fit. Ten years after enrolling, the median graduate earns $30,512 per year according to U.S. Department of Education earnings tracking.

Admissions

University of Puerto Rico-Arecibo accepts 59% of applicants, making it moderately selective.
